“Not happy”
2 of 5 stars Reviewed February 21, 2013

We went up to Chicago for the weekend and decided to stay at Embassy for the location and amenities. The hotel was under renovation which I knew about, however, as a silver HH member they put me in a room on the 3rd floor directly over the construction area. The room was noisy too. Front desk staff was not helpful or friendly at check-out... Nobody asked me how my stay was at check out... I was told I had to move my truck by 3pm or they would charge me another $50 on top of the $100 I had already paid for the weekend. I stay in Chicago all the time at the CY Marriott Mag Mile and have never experienced anything like this... The only good thing about the stay was the breakfast was one of the best I have ever had at an Embassy.

“Could not have been worse experience for our wedding reception weekend….”
1 of 5 stars Reviewed February 19, 2013

I will try to stick to the facts however it was disappointment after disappointment this past weekend. My husband and I booked 4 rooms at the Embassy Suites to host family for our wedding reception weekend. We are also Platinum Members at this hotel chain, we travel a lot. We knew when we booked the rooms that the hotel was doing some ‘renovation’ work. The website and employee we spoke a month before we booked the 4 rooms assured us the majority of the construction and renovation would be completed by the time mid-February. Upon arrival on Thursday, there were school groups all of over the hotel. Only two of four elevators were working so it took about 10-15 mins to even get on an elevator (each elevator held about 6-7 people comfortably minus luggage). I don't mind taking the stairs, but its harder when you are 7 months pregnant. From there our ‘experience’ went on a downhill on a runaway train:

•The free breakfast, was literally next to a construction area. So the omelet station was four campfire burners and you got to smell the fumes from the construction while enjoying your breakfast.

•Thursday-Sunday, either only one or two of the elevators were functioning. It was about a 20-30 min wait for the elevator during the day.

•Since the elevator took so long, all of the guests had to take the stairs. Which would be fine if I was not 7 months pregnant!

•On Sunday after finally getting an elevator after 10 mins, my family and I were seating and waiting in the lobby to go to the airport with our luggage. A hotel employee comes over to us and says “we need everyone in the lobby to leave so we can take a photo.” I asked her “where can I sit then?” She says “Oh , just take the elevator to the second floor.” That is fine if I was not 7 months pregnant and had to wait 10-15 mins because you have one working elevator!

•After speaking to the hotel manager and another front desk employee, their response was
“Sorry, there’s nothing we can do." or " I don't know when the elevators will be working again."

We will never stay at the Embassy Suites in Downtown Chicago again. One of the worst experiences I have ever had.

“Nice property, I wish parents would keep screaming kids out of hallways”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ed February 19, 2013

Remember when Embassy Suites (and all it's previous iterations) came on line in the 80's? Everybody loved them, then over the last 30 years so many of the properties became run down, and there were half baked renovations and re-do's? Well, this property is an exception! Great renovation, top to bottom! Beautiful room, nice public spaces, incredible location! The only issue is that this is still a property that, due to the amenities, attracts a lot of families. Coupled with the open atrium design and parents that don't seem to care meant a constant cacophony of screaming and running children that could be heard throughout the property. So, nice place, but if you are planning on staying out late in Chi-town and sleeping in you might want to check out a quieter property. I will most likely stay here again, but not on a holiday weekend.

“Wow -- this is nice !”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ed February 18, 2013

I booked a last-minute trip over the holiday weekend for a girl's night out with my daughter. The location is ultra-convenient to just about everything!! It's a short walk to the El station (which we rode from the suburbs), there's a grocery store across the street, and of course Michigan Ave is just 3 blocks away. The room was clean (with the exception of cloudy, food-specked drinking glasses and dark fingerprint smudges on the bedroom door). The manager's reception is a nice gesture, but we skipped it -- the lines for beverages can be long. The morning breakfast with made-to-order omelets is OUTSTANDING!! There is construction on the 2nd floor and it appeared only 2 of 4 elevators were working (so be prepared to wait -- or use the stairs). The doormen were friendly and made us feel welcomed. The pool and work-out rooms were nicely maintained. If we ever spend another night in Chicago to play "tourists", this will be our first pick. Thanks ESH!
